First story
In the deep blue sea there was a “Blue Pebble”. He rolled about the sea wherever the waves would carry him. Along the way he met fishes, other pebbles, sea urchins, starfish, corals and seaweed.
One day, he found nine pebbles which became his arms and legs (limbs). Together they played, and sometimes the waves would split them up, so they would seek each other again, sometimes for a very long time.
On a special beach where the “Blue Pebble” rolled onto the sand, a girl picked it up and took it home.
There it saw a bunch of other pebbles of different shapes and colors. The girl drew all sorts of doodles, smiley faces, cactuses, strawberries on her pebbles… but on Blue Pebble she only drew a small wave. She said that Blue Pebble is beautiful just as it is and that it reminds her of the sea.
When she grew up a little, she had to move to another place, so she brought all the pebbles back to the beach.
The color washed off, and “Blue Pebble” , as well as the other pebbles, kept on rolling through the seas.
